Output 584f8a60ad19681399e76b663e5c449a4987d253523567303cff16a9b2014019:16

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58e32ee7ea06a3d6086def22fe0219c2e54c62f9765ab637b98c6a2263d45fd3
address
bc1ptr3jael2q63avzrdau30uqsectj5cchewedtvdae334zyc75tlfst2tty5
transaction
584f8a60ad19681399e76b663e5c449a4987d253523567303cff16a9b2014019
spent
true